ULM to Host Annual CBSS Symposium with Resilience Keynote

The College of Business and Social Sciences is set to hold its annual premier lecture and seminar series from October 27-30, 2025. The symposium will center on the theme "Superpowers: Discover Yours, Transform the World" and will feature a keynote address by resilience expert Jim Davidson, elevator pitch competition, a career fair and numerous speaker sessions open to the public.

The centerpiece of the symposium is the keynote address, "Everest Resilience: Overcoming Adversity and Reaching High Goals," delivered by Davidson on Wednesday, October 29, at 11:00 a.m. at Bayou Point Event Center.
Davidson, a noted resilience expert, will share insights drawn from his experience surviving two major mountain disasters. His presentation will cover practical strategies for perseverance, team work, leadership, and post-traumatic growth gathered from his 42 years of global adventures.

Students looking to sharpen their professional skills can participate in the Elevator Pitch Competition on Tuesday, October 28, from 3 to 4:30 p.m. in The Hangar, hosted in partnership with the Office of Career Development. Participants will have 90 seconds to deliver their best pitch for a chance to win prizes—and audience members can win too through door prize drawings.

The friendly rivalry continues later in the week with the CBSS Brain Bowl on Wednesday, October 29, from 4 to 6 p.m. in The Hangar, where teams of students, faculty, and professionals will compete in a fast-paced trivia challenge representing each school within the College.

All CBSS Symposium sessions are free and open to the public. Students are encouraged to attend, network, and take advantage of opportunities to connect with professionals and alumni.
